Sealed For Protection
Cavities are an all too common dental problem that can creep up on you without notice — no matter how well you take care of your teeth. One of the best ways we can help you avoid this type of tooth decay is by sealing your teeth so that they are protected from harmful bacteria.
Dental sealants are a thin coating of material that is painted on to your molars to prevent cavities from forming. These back teeth, with their grooves and pits, tend to trap food debris that bacteria feed on, resulting in tiny holes in the enamel. The sealant acts as a barrier to bacteria and can protect your teeth for up to 10 years.
This preventative treatment is highly recommend for several reasons:
- Reducing risk of cavities: Sealants can stop cavities from forming by up to 86% according to the American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ry.
- Prevention: Bacteria, plaque and food debris are prevented from sticking to your teeth, which is the reason cavities form.
- Unnoticeable: You won’t even realize you have sealants on your teeth, but you will notice that you won’t have to worry about cavities for years to come. They don’t interfere with how you chew, or the look of your teeth, either.
- Time saver: The treatment is quick and painless, and will help you avoid needing to have fillings.
Just because you have sealants, however, doesn’t mean you don’t have to brush and floss every day. It’s important to keep up with your regular dental hygiene routine and get a professional cleaning and exam every six months.
